Output e56f72310f973c1d3b689d665904880dfca257cec22a4967fb0ebc544685adab:3

value
12217346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fe84ef3ab72914e797fd06caf5e38af6cfcf53 OP_EQUAL
address
39oaHjXo6tKUJg2qRJ7LMN3r2TCuKRRypT
transaction
e56f72310f973c1d3b689d665904880dfca257cec22a4967fb0ebc544685adab
spent
true